The equation of the circle whose radius is 3 and which touches internally the circle (x^2+y^2-4 x-6 y-12=0 ) at the point ((-1,-1) ) is

Options

  1. A(5 x^2+5 y^2+9 x-6 y-7=0 )
  2. B(5 x^2+5 y^2-8 x-14 y-32=0 )
  3. C(5 x^2+5 y^2-6 x+8 y-8=0 )
  4. D(5 x^2+5 y^2+6 x-8 y-12=0 )

Correct answer

B. (5 x^2+5 y^2-8 x-14 y-32=0 )

Step-by-step solution

Equation of given circle is (x^2+y^2-4 x-6 y-12=0 ) having centre (C₁(2,3) ) and radius (r₁= 4+9+12 =5 ). Let the required circle having centre (C₂(h, k) ) and radius is given as 3 touches the given circle at (A(-1,-1) ). The point (A(-1,-1) ) divides the line joining the centres (C₁(2,3) ) and (C₂(h, k) ) externally in (5: 3 ) so ( aligned & (-1,-1)= ( 5 h-3(2) 5-3 , 5 k-3(3) 5-3 ) & (-1,-1)= ( 5 h-6 2 , 5 k-9 2 ) & 5 h-6=-2 and 5 k-9=-2 & h= 4 5 and k= 7 5 aligned ) so equation of required circle is ( aligned & (
